Coffee farmer Francois Serikpa Dadi, from Brazil, is one of Coffeedent's fair farmers taking part in BeCoffeedents plan to reform the coffeeindustry. The 65-year-old started farming when he retired about a quarter of a century ago.
The former bus chauffeur, who has 12 children and 21 grandchildren, started farming cocoa, before growing coffee and palm oil.
When BeCoffeedent was founded in 2010, Dadi was encouraged to attend training sessions with other local farmers in Brazil.
“We believe in coffee because farming is part of our ancestral culture”, said Dadi. “Coffee provides us food, clothes and everything we need to live. This is our hope for the future”.
BeCoffeedent makes it possible that Dadi is able to increase his income through an improvement of its production and boost this with an average of 300-400 kgs per hectare.
